Binance Terms of Service Explained Binance’s Terms of Service explicitly prohibit selling, transferring, or leasing accounts. Each account is tied to an individual’s identity verified through KYC. Attempting to bypass this can result in: Account suspension Asset freezing Permanent bans Legal liability depending on jurisdiction Ownership Transfer Rules Unlike traditional bank accounts, Binance accounts are non-transferable. Ownership is linked to the verified identity. If someone tries to sell or gift an account, Binance considers it a breach of contract. Real-life example: A trader bought a verified Binance account to bypass restrictions. Later, Binance flagged suspicious activity, froze funds, and reported the case to regulators. KYC/AML Compliance and Risks KYC and AML laws require exchanges to verify user identities and monitor suspicious transactions. Binance banned all accounts. Step-by-Step Guide to Safe Transfers Avoid direct account transfers – use wallet-to-wallet crypto transfers instead. Document transactions – keep records for tax and legal purposes. Consult legal experts – especially for inheritance or business transfers.
